The PGA Championship takes place this week at TPC Harding Park in San Francisco. World No. 1 Justin Thomas and defending champion Brooks Koepka are the current favorites in the tournament, and fans will tune in to see Tiger Woods return Thursday morning. 

Here’s how to watch the tournament, beginning Thursday, August 6 and running through the weekend. 

Here’s the schedule of events from ESPN.

Thursday, August 6

  • 10 a.m.- 4 p.m. on ESPN+: First-round coverage
  • 10 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 1
  • 10 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 2
  • 4 p.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N: First-round action

Friday, August 7

  • Midnight-5:30 a.m. on ESPN2: First-round encore
  • 10 a.m.- 4 p.m. on ESPN+: Second-round coverage
  • 10 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 1
  • 10 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 2
  • 4 p.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N: Second-round coverage.

Saturday

  • 11 a.m.-1 p.m. on ESPN+: Third-round coverage
  • 11 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Feature group No. 1
  • 11 a.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Feature group No. 2
  • 1 p.m.-4 p.m. on ESPN: Third-round coverage.
  • 4 p.m.-10 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ured hole (18th)

Sunday

  • 10 a.m.-noon on ESPN+: Final-round coverage
  • 10 a.m.-9 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 1
  • 10 a.m.-9 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ured group No. 2
  • Noon-3 p.m. on ESPN: Final-round coverage.
  • 3 p.m.-9 p.m. on ESPN+: Featured hole (18th)
